What to Check Before Creating an Account
Registration should be straightforward, but straightforward does not mean careless. A player should confirm the operator’s legal entity, licence information, accepted jurisdictions, age requirement, and responsible gambling tools before entering payment details. If these facts are difficult to locate, that is not a mysterious sign of sophistication; it is a reason to slow down.
- Confirm that the casino accepts players from your country.
- Read the terms attached to deposits, bonuses, and withdrawals.
- Check minimum and maximum transaction limits.
- Review identity verification requirements before playing.
- Locate self-exclusion, deposit-limit, and session-control features.
Account verification may request identity and address documents. That can feel bureaucratic, particularly when the games are available in seconds, but it helps operators meet anti-money-laundering obligations. The sensible move is to submit clear, current documents through the official cashier or support channel rather than sending personal information through improvised routes.
Game Lobby and Software Quality
Variety matters, although quantity alone is a poor judge. A lobby containing thousands of near-identical slots can resemble a supermarket aisle where every cereal box has a different mascot but the same ingredients. More useful indicators include recognised studios, transparent game rules, mobile compatibility, and reliable loading across ordinary connections.
| Area | What players should examine | Why it matters |
|---|---|---|
| Slots | Volatility, RTP, paylines, and feature rules | Helps match games with personal risk tolerance |
| Live casino | Table limits, streaming stability, and rules | Prevents surprises during real-time play |
| Table games | Variants, side bets, and house edge | Rules can change the mathematical outcome |
| Mobile play | Navigation, login speed, and cashier access | Small screens expose poor design quickly |
Slots should display information such as return to player, volatility, and maximum win conditions where available. RTP is a long-run statistical figure, not a promise for one evening. A machine showing 96% RTP can still deliver a very cold session; probability has no obligation to protect a player’s mood.
Live Tables and Game Fairness
Live dealer rooms deserve a separate check because presentation can distract from rules. Compare minimum stakes, side-bet payouts, dealing procedures, and the treatment of interrupted rounds. In digital table games, an independent testing certificate and a visible random-number-generator statement offer useful reassurance, though neither turns a losing bet into a winning one.
Deposits, Withdrawals, and Verification
Payment options should be assessed by speed, fees, limits, and whether the method supports withdrawals as well as deposits. Cards, bank transfers, e-wallets, and alternative payment services can each behave differently. A method that accepts money instantly may still require a separate route for cashing out, which is the sort of detail players prefer to discover before, rather than after, a win.
- Check the deposit minimum and maximum for each method.
- Look for processing fees and currency-conversion costs.
- Confirm whether withdrawals return to the original payment source.
- Read the estimated processing window and weekend policy.
- Keep transaction records until the payment is complete.
Withdrawal delays are not automatically evidence of wrongdoing; manual checks, document reviews, and banking queues can take time. Still, vague status messages are frustrating, and support should explain what is happening without sending players on a treasure hunt through six departments. Clear timelines are a sign of competent operations.
Bonuses Without the Fog Machine
Promotions can add value, but their arithmetic deserves more attention than their banners. A welcome offer may include wagering requirements, maximum qualifying stakes, restricted games, expiry periods, contribution percentages, and a maximum cashout. These conditions are not decorative wallpaper. They define the offer.
| Term | Meaning | Player question |
|---|---|---|
| Wagering requirement | Amount that must be staked before eligible funds can be withdrawn | Is it based on the bonus, deposit, or both? |
| Game contribution | How much a game counts toward wagering | Do slots contribute fully while tables contribute less? |
| Maximum stake | Highest permitted bet during wagering | What happens if the limit is exceeded? |
| Expiry | Deadline for completing the offer | Is the clock measured in hours or days? |
My cautious view is simple: calculate the effective cost before accepting any promotion. A bonus with a bright percentage and restrictive conditions may be less useful than a smaller, clearer offer. Casino marketing loves a large number; disciplined players love readable rules.
Support, Safety, and Final Assessment
Customer support should be reachable through at least one practical channel, with response quality tested using ordinary questions about verification, limits, and withdrawals. Live chat is convenient, while email creates a written record. The real test arrives when something goes wrong, because every operator looks efficient while nothing is broken.
Responsible play belongs in the evaluation, not as a footnote. Set a budget before opening the lobby, avoid chasing losses, use deposit limits, and take breaks. Gambling should remain paid entertainment, not a financial rescue plan wearing a spinning-wheel costume.
